As a seasoned crypto investor who’s traded through multiple market cycles, I’ve watched Coinbase Global, Inc. (COIN) evolve from a startup exchange to a major player in the digital asset space. Founded in 2012 by Brian Armstrong and Fred Ehrsam, Coinbase has built a reputation for regulatory compliance and user-friendly services, including trading, staking, and wallets. With its stock listed on Nasdaq since 2021, COIN often moves in sync with broader crypto trends. Coinbase Global, Inc. (COIN) Potential Risks and Challenges
Investing in COIN isn’t without hurdles. Market volatility remains a big one—crypto sentiment can swing wildly, and as analyst Cathie Wood of ARK Invest has pointed out, “COIN’s fortunes are tied to adoption waves that can evaporate quickly.” Competition from exchanges like Binance adds pressure, potentially eroding market share. Regulatory risks loom large; while Coinbase prioritizes compliance, shifts in U.S. laws on stablecoins could impose costs or restrictions. Technically, reliance on blockchain infrastructure means vulnerabilities like network congestion or hacks could indirectly hit stock value, challenging the assumption that regulated entities are immune. Addressing objections, some argue COIN’s diversification into derivatives mitigates this, but history shows even giants face obsolescence if ecosystems stagnate.
